Buffer: Buffer is a social media management platform that allows users to schedule posts, analyze performance, and manage multiple social media accounts from one dashboard. It helps streamline social media marketing workflows.

Toolsley Binary Inspector: Toolsley Binary Inspector is a software program that allows users to analyze and inspect binary files. It can parse executable files, object code, libraries, and more to show metadata, strings, structure, dependencies, and other information.

Toolsley Binary Inspector
Toolsley Binary Inspector Features
  • Disassembles executable files and libraries
  • Parses and analyzes binary file headers
  • Extracts strings and metadata from binary files
  • Identifies dependencies and relationships between binary components
  • Supports inspection of PE, ELF, Mach-O and other binary formats
  • Provides hex editor for manual inspection of binary content
  • Generates reports and exports analysis results
